How To Make Cheesy Chicken Ranch Potatoes
This chicken ranch potatoes casserole is an easy weeknight meal that is loaded with cheese, bacon, chicken breasts, potatoes, and ranch dressing.

Ingredients
- 3chicken breasts,cubed
- 2lbsred potatoes
- ½cupranch dressing,(store-bought or homemade)
- ½cupsour cream
- ½tsppepper
- ½tspgarlic powder
- ½tspdill
- ½tspparsley
- 1¼cupcheese,cheddar or any desired blend, shredded, divided
- 8slicesbacon,cooked, crisp & crumbled
- 4green onions,thinly sliced
Instructions
-
Preheat oven to 375 degrees F.
-
Wash potatoes and cut into 1-inch cubes.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add potatoes and cook 12 to 15 minutes or until tender.
-
Meanwhile, season chicken with salt & pepper. Over medium heat, fry chicken for 6 to 8 minutes until no pink remains.
-
In medium bowl, combine ranch dressing, sour cream, ¾ cup cheese, and seasonings. Mix well.
-
Place chicken and potatoes into a greased 9×13-inch pan. Sprinkle with half of the bacon and half of the green onions. Spread sauce over top.
-
Top with remaining cheese and bake 35 minutes uncovered or until browned and bubbly.
-
Remove from the oven, sprinkle with remaining bacon and green onions. Serve with sour cream if desired.
